Garlic Butter Sausage Bites with Creamy Parmesan Shells

A delightful dish that combines savory Italian sausage with creamy Parmesan shells, perfect for quick weeknight dinners or impressing guests.
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 20 minutes
Total Time 30 minutes
Servings: 4 servings
Course: Dinner, Main Course
Cuisine: Italian
Calories: 600

Ingredients
  

For the Sausage and Sauce
  • 1 lb Italian sausage (mild or hot)—casing removed and cut into bite-sized pieces
  • 2 tbsp olive oil
  • 3 tbsp unsalted butter
  • 1 tbsp minced garlic
  • 1 cup heavy cream
  • 1 cup chicken broth
  • 1 cup grated Parmesan cheese
  • 1/2 cup shredded mozzarella cheese (optional for extra creaminess) Add if desired for more creaminess
  • 1/2 tsp Italian seasoning
  • 1/4 cup reserved pasta water (as needed) Use to adjust sauce consistency
  • Fresh parsley or basil to taste chopped (optional garnish) For garnish
For the Pasta
  • 12 oz pasta shells Can substitute with other pasta shapes

Method
 

Cooking Pasta
  1.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il. Cook the pasta shells according to package directions until al dente. Reserve 1/4 cup of the pasta water, drain, and set the shells aside.
Cooking Sausage
  1. In a large skillet, heat the olive oil over medium-high heat. Add the sausage bites and cook until browned and fully cooked, about 5–6 minutes. Remove from the skillet and set aside.
Making the Sauce
  1. Lower the heat to medium and add the butter and minced garlic to the skillet, cooking for about 30 seconds, or until fragrant.
  2. Pour in the heavy cream and chicken broth, bringing the mixture to a gentle simmer. Stir in the grated Parmesan cheese (and mozzarella if desired) until the sauce is creamy and smooth.
Combining Ingredients
  1. Toss in the cooked pasta shells, coating them well with the sauce. If the sauce seems too thick, gradually add some of the reserved pasta water to achieve the desired consistency.
  2. Return the sausage bites to the skillet, mixing everything together and allowing it to simmer for an additional 1–2 minutes so the flavors meld.
  3. Finally, sprinkle with Italian seasoning, adjust seasoning with salt and black pepper to taste, and garnish with chopped parsley or basil before serving hot.

Notes

If you have leftovers, store in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to three days. Reheat on the stovetop, adding a splash of chicken broth or milk to maintain the creamy texture.
